Kaunas district launches first citizens' assembly on healthcare

The Kaunas district municipality has launched its first citizens' assembly, a direct democracy initiative designed to involve residents in local decision-making. A group of 30 citizens, selected by lottery from 174 applicants, represents various age groups and 23 different elderships within the district.

The assembly's primary focus is to address how to ensure that preventive healthcare services are accessible to all population groups. Participants will study regional health indicators, examine the functioning of national and municipal health systems, and listen to expert presentations to identify barriers to timely health check-ups.

The process is structured in three stages: theoretical preparation and expert briefings, facilitated group discussions, and a final official vote on recommendations. Once completed, the resulting document of recommendations will be submitted to the Kaunas district mayor and the municipal council for evaluation and potential implementation into local health policy.
